Guangxi follows central govt example

By Huo Yan and Li Aoxue | China Daily | Updated: 2008-11-13 07:44

The Guangxi Zhuang autonomous region will spend 300 billion yuan ($44 billion) on transport projects in the next five years, following the central government's call to boost the economy by increasing investment.

"After the projects are completed, Guangxi will have a comprehensive transport network linking it to neighboring provinces and many Association of Southeast Asian Nations (ASEAN) countries," the region's governor Ma Biao said at an economic forum on Tuesday.

The region will spend 115 billion yuan on railways to extend the tracks by at least 2,180 km. And it will spend 120 billion yuan to build or expand highways and expressways.
